  • Job Description Summary

Valmont is currently seeking a highly motivated and talented individual for the Technical Machine Operator (Automated Painting Process) position in the Composite department. We are looking for a highly driven individual that will set up and run various profiles and all variations of machines according to line package specifications. This position will support the paint department in preparing hardware for various coatings. The position applies knowledge of mechanical principles in determining equipment malfunctions, conveyor systems for material handling and applies skills in restoring equipment to operation. Additionally, you will

  • Run various profiles and machine according to line package specifications

  • Maintain knowledge of technical documentation for spray coating, powder coating and industrial printing process including product specifications, application guidelines, troubleshooting guides, and training materials.

  • Mix various paints for spray applications and touchups using specific ratios defined by manufacturer and/or customer specifications.

  • Surface preparation for painting operations including abrading and cleaning surfaces using various solvents.

  • Detailed masking utilizing paper, tape, rubber, and 3d printed materials. Hanging delicate hardware on racks and carts

  • Responsible for Paint mixing systems. Submitting paint usage, mix ratios, cure times, and thickness readings.

  • Assist in the installation, maintenance, and repair of machinery,

  • Operate tools in order to aid in the manufacturing process

  • Perform periodic checks on equipment and solve problems as detected

  • Maintain work area and equipment in a clean, safe and orderly condition

  • Follow all standard and/or prescribed safety regulations

  • Follow all standard operating procedures

  • Train and assist in development of less experience personnel

  • Proper housekeeping of your area at all times

About the Company

V

Valmont Industries Inc

Valmont Industries began in 1946 when our founder, Robert B. Daugherty combined his $5,000 savings and wholehearted belief that business could and should be done better. Since that modest start more than half a century ago, our company has grown to be an international leader in engineered products and services for infrastructure and water-conserving irrigation equipment for agriculture. From the lighting and traffic structures that guide your way, to communication towers and utility structures that power your home and business, to irrigation equipment that waters the croplands on which your food is grown, Valmont products improve lives worldwide.
